TRIUMF T wenty-five years ago, the innovative management team at Atomic Energy of Canada Ltd. (AECL) recognized the potential of cyclotron-produced radioisotopes for medical science advancement. From that vision emerged the remarkably successful alliance between TRIUMF and AECL. Since the 1950s, AECL has been producing isotopes using nuclear reactors. In 1978, AECL’s Commercial Products Division ap- proached TRIUMF about using its 500 MeV cyclotron to produce other radioisotopes. The result was the flourishing collaborative research and production site located at TRIUMF on the University of British Colum- bia’s campus. Since its inception it has created benefits for both medical science and economic growth. In 1979 AECL’s Commercial Products Division was renamed the Radiochemical Company, and 3 years later began exporting cyclotron-produced isotopes from the TRIUMF site. Two smaller cyclotrons were subse- quently purchased and used exclusively by the AECL for the commercial production of isotopes. One of these was designed and commissioned by TRIUMF staff. In 1991, AECL privatized its operations under the name Nordion International Inc., which was later ac- quired by MDS Inc., a Canadian-based international health and life sciences company, and renamed MDS Nordion Inc. MDS Nordion’s headquarters are in Kanata, On- tario. In addition to the TRIUMF site, it has operations running in Belgium (reactor and cyclotron isotope pro- duction, radiopharmaceuticals), Laval, Quebec (re- search, training and testing of cobalt-60 irradiators), Germany (brachytherapy systems and radiography cam- eras), Sweden (devel- opment of computer products and soft- ware, and accessories for radiation ther- apy), as well as of- fices in Japan and Hong Kong which serve the Pacific Rim. Total corporate annual sales are approximately $350 million, over 95% of which are exported to some 80 different countries. MDS Nordion’s Vancouver operation on the TRIUMF site currently employs 50 full-time permanent staff and 22 contract staff. These 22 contract staff are TRIUMF employees, supported by Nordion on a full- time, cost-recovery basis and they are responsible for the operation of Nordion’s two compact commercial cyclotrons. To date, the cumulative sales of MDS Nordion in Vancouver have exceeded $200 million. The licensing agreements between TRIUMF and MDS Nordion have resulted in royalties of several million dollars that TRIUMF has uti- lized as supplementary funding for further research, as well as related technological activities that support the transfer of TRIUMF technologies to Ca- nadian industry. Nordion’s operation at TRIUMF is unique in Canada. In fact, it is one of only a few sites worldwide that produces cyclotron-based isotopes. Ac- cording to the U.S. Institute of Medicine, there are over 36,000 diagnostic medical procedures employing radioisotopes per- formed in the United States each day. About 100 million laboratory tests using radioiso- topes are performed there each year. TRIUMFthe following radioisotopes under license fromTRIUMF for sale worldwide:

• palladium-103, used for prostate cancertherapy;

• strontium-82, used for high resolution heartimaging to detect coronary artery diseaseand for diagnosing bone lesions;

• thallium-201, widely used as a heartimaging agent;

• indium-111, used in blood cell labeling, asa heart imaging agent and to locatetumours;

• gallium-67, used to detect such conditionsas Hodgkin’s disease;

• cobalt-57, used as a marker to estimateorgan size/location, and for diagnosis ofanaemia related to vitamin B12deficiency;

• iodine-123, used traditionally for thyroidimaging, also currently made into aradiopharmaceutical for neurologicaldiagnosis of Parkinson’s disease,schizophrenia and Alzheimer’s disease, inoncology for cancer imaging (e.g. breastcancer), and in cardiology for imagingcardiac tissue.

Since the 1950s, nuclear medicine has becomean increasingly important and utilized part of pa-tient care. The procedures are generally safe andpainless. Only very small amounts of the radioiso-tope or radiopharmaceutical are needed to diag-nose and treat disease. When introduced into thebody these substances are attracted to specificbones, tissues or organs. Because these substancesare radioactive they decay emitting radiation thatcan be detected using special types of cameras that showthe distribution of the isotope in the body. Both reactor-and cyclotron-produced radioisotopes emit gamma raysbut only the cyclotron produced ones also emit the posi-

trons that are essentialfor PET scans. Theimages so obtainedprovide physicianswith critical informa-

tion on how the body is functioning. This in turn helpsthem to diagnose disease, determine the best course oftreatment, and monitor the progress of the treatment.Current studies at TRIUMF are showing the promise ofusing radioisotopes to treat cancerous growths, result-ing in significantly less trauma to the patient than caused

by the traditional methods.MDS Nordion is the only Canadian supplier of many

of these crucial radioisotopes. Through its licensingagreements with TRIUMF, Nordion has first rights tothe cutting-edge isotope technology originating fromTRIUMF research. This ensures timely disseminationof the technology, while delivering the maximum bene-fit to the Canadian economy.

The demand for radioisotopes has grown each yearas diagnostic techniques and screening capabilities haveincreased. To help satisfy the growing demand,Nordion is investing $20 million to build a new com-mercial cyclotron facility at its TRIUMF site. This newfacility will increase MDS Nordion’s radioisotope pro-duction capacity in Vancouver in order to help meet the

TRIUMFever-growing demand for iodine-123and palladium-103. The new cyclotronwill bring with it an extension to thecurrent building that houses the Van-couver MDS Nordion team. Construc-tion began in 2001 and production isexpected to begin in January, 2003. Inaddition to meeting global demandsfor medical isotopes, the new facilitywill create additional opportunities forhigh quality employment. By the year2006, it is projected that there will be53 employees and 31 contract employ-ees, all of them in highly skilled posi-tions.

MDS Nordion is now working atfull capacity to ensure that the demandfor high-priority isotopes is met. Thenew cyclotron will be capable of meet-ing additional demands for these andother existing products. The increase in production andexport will also assist TRIUMF and Nordion in contin-uing their research and development of new cyclotron-

produced isotopes,which will further ad-vance the Canadiannuclear medicine in-

dustry. The improved radioisotope production capabil-ity of Nordion at the TRIUMF site is estimated to pro-vide products for 1,000,000 nuclear medicineprocedures around the world each year.

The synergistic benefits flowing from the long-termrelationship between the TRIUMF universities andMDS Nordion are manifold and well recognized byNordion’s customers. TRIUMF has provided and con-tinues to provide leading-edge research skills to MDSNordion. At the same time, MDS Nordion has intro-duced the concept of the marketplace to TRIUMF staff,as well as the potential social and economic benefits thatcan flow from the practical application of scientific skillsand knowledge.

The success of the TRIUMF-Nordion partnershiphas not been based on any one strategy or set of strate-

gies. It started with a sharing of knowledge and has suc-ceeded because of the level of mutual trust and respectthe two parties have established. Both parties recognisethat, while working together, each must respect the factthat they are two discrete entities and must remain inde-pendent; that the synergy from the relationship lies inthe strength of the other’s difference; and that the col-laboration is a joint effort, where either success or fail-ure affects both parties equally. Further developmentsare under way, with TRIUMF working on new types oftargets, new calibration sources, and cyclotron improve-ments, and with Nordion expanding its radioisotopeproduct line. These developments are aimed at makingstill further advances into the cost-effective productionand delivery of short-lived radioisotopes to the healthcare system.

Looking back, the TRIUMF-Nordion co-operationof the past 25 years has been a major Canadian successstory. As a result of this success, Canada is now one ofthe world’s major suppliers of cyclotron-produced ra-dioisotopes, and the future holds even greater promise.
